Painting Description
James Watterston Herald's "Mother and Child" is a poignant and evocative artwork that captures the intimate bond between a mother and her offspring. Herald, a Scottish artist known for his contributions to the Arts and Crafts movement, created this piece during a period when he was deeply engaged in exploring themes of familial relationships and domestic life. The artwork is often celebrated for its delicate portrayal of maternal affection and the serene, almost ethereal quality that Herald imbues in his subjects.
Herald's technique in "Mother and Child" showcases his mastery of form and his ability to convey deep emotion through subtle details. The composition is carefully balanced, with the figures of the mother and child positioned in a way that emphasizes their connection. The mother's gentle embrace and the child's trusting posture are rendered with a sensitivity that speaks to Herald's keen observational skills and his empathy for his subjects.
The use of light and shadow in the artwork further enhances its emotional impact. Herald employs a soft, diffused light that bathes the figures in a warm glow, creating a sense of tranquility and intimacy. This use of light not only highlights the physical closeness of the mother and child but also symbolizes the nurturing and protective nature of their relationship.
"Mother and Child" is also notable for its stylistic elements that reflect Herald's involvement in the Arts and Crafts movement. The attention to detail, the emphasis on craftsmanship, and the harmonious composition are all hallmarks of this artistic movement, which sought to celebrate the beauty of everyday life and the value of handmade artistry.
Overall, "Mother and Child" by James Watterston Herald is a timeless piece that continues to resonate with viewers for its universal theme and its exquisite execution. It stands as a testament to Herald's artistic vision and his ability to capture the profound connections that define human experience.
